Job description

## Description**Job Summary:**The School Bus Driver is responsible for the safe and reliable transportation of students to and from school, field trips, and other related activities. The bus driver ensures compliance with safety standards, follows designated routes, and maintains positive relationships with students, parents, and school staff. Kobussen Buses is a third-generation, family-owned transportation company with over 1,100 employees throughout the state of Wisconsin.**Key Responsibilities:****Safe Transportation:*** Operate a school bus in a safe, professional manner while adhering to all traffic laws and company policies.* Conduct thorough pre-trip and post-trip inspections to ensure the vehicle is in proper working order.* Follow assigned routes and schedules while ensuring students arrive on time.* Implement proper loading and unloading procedures, ensuring student safety at all times.**Student Management:*** Maintain order and enforce bus safety rules during transport.* Build positive relationships with students while promoting respectful behavior on the bus.* Communicate concerns about student conduct to appropriate school and company personnel.**Compliance & Safety:*** Follow all company, state, and federal regulations, including Department of Transportation (DOT) and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) guidelines.* Participate in required safety training, including emergency evacuation drills.* Promptly report any incidents, accidents, or mechanical issues.**Customer Relations:*** Maintain courteous and professional communication with parents, school staff, and the community.* Represent the company positively while interacting with clients and passengers.**Administrative Duties:*** Maintain accurate records of student counts, route details, and vehicle inspections.* Submit required paperwork such as time logs and maintenance reports in a timely manner.## Qualifications**Education & Experience:*** High school diploma or GED required.* Previous experience in school bus driving, commercial driving, or passenger transportation preferred.**Qualifications:*** 21+ years old* Valid driver’s license for past three years* Must possess a valid Commercial Driver’s License (CDL) with Passenger (P) and School Bus (S) endorsements (**or be willing to obtain them with company-provided training**).* Proven driving experience with a clean driving record.* Ability to pass a background check, drug screening, and DOT physical.* Strong communication and interpersonal skills.* Commitment to ensuring student safety and well-being.* Ability to lift up to 50 pounds.**Work Environment:*** Early morning and afternoon split shifts with occasional mid-day or evening assignments.* Ability to sit for extended periods and perform moderate lifting.* Outdoor work with potential exposure to varying weather conditions.**Pay & Benefits:*** Competitive hourly wage based on experience* Paid training* 401(k) retirement plan* Flexible hours/shifts* Bring your child(ren) to work* Quarterly bonus program* Companywide activities and parties
